WPS Settings
WPS Settings: WPS can help you to add a new wireless device to an existing network
quickly. This section will guide you how to use WPS function.
• WPS state: Display the current WPS state.
• WPS mode: If the wireless adapter supports Wi-Fi Protected Setup (WPS), you can
establish a wireless connection between wireless adapter and modem router using either
Push Button Configuration (PBC) method or PIN method, please select the one you
want.
• WPS progress: Show the current WPS progress.
• Reset to OOB: Use this button to reset the WPS state to “unconfigured”, so that a new
key will be created when using WPS function next time.
1) PBC
If the wireless adapter supports Wi-Fi Protected Setup and the Push Button Configuration
(PBC) method, you can add it to the network by PBC with the following two methods. Click
PBC, you will see the screen as shown below.
